The October 2022 issue of the Official LEGO Star Wars Magazine is available on newsstands for €6.99 and it gets us a 34-piece TIE Whisper as planned. No paper bag like Thanos did with the Official LEGO Marvel Avengers Magazine last month.
The next issue of this magazine will be available from November 9 and it will allow us to obtain a minifig of Princess Leia. This figurine is far from new, it was already delivered in two sets: the references 75244 Tantive IV (2019) et 75301 Luke Skywalker X-wing Fighter (2021)
For those who are interested, I remind you that the instructions of the different mini-models delivered with this magazine are available in PDF format on the publisher's website. Simply enter the code on the back of the bag to obtain the file, 912288 for the TIE Whisper delivered with this number.
Finally, be aware that it is currently possible to subscribe for a period of six months or a year to the official LEGO Star Wars magazine via the abo-online.fr platform. The 12-month subscription (13 issues) costs € 65.
